ATF.Treas.gov ATF Online
The Burea of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ms, and Explosiveser under the U.S. Department of Justice keeps an online database of its most wanted individuals with outstanding charges. The database spans all states and as such, this is also an excellent source for free IL State criminal records.
ATF Online is an initiative taken by ATF to combat violent crime in cooperation with other federal, state, and local law enforcement agencies. The wanted persons on the ATF list are the result of ATF criminal investigations, often in conjuction with other law enforcement agencies. These investigations resulted in the issuance of a federal arrest warrant to subjects who fit the following criteria: seriousness of the crime committed, past criminal record of the defendant, potential for the defendant to be a dangerous menace to society, based on the current or past charges, and belief that publicity afforded by the program will be of assistance in apprehending the wanted person.
FBI.gov Federal Bureau of Investigation
The Federal Bureau of Investigation has perhaps the largest database of free IL State criminal records as well as those from other states. The name of this database is the National Crime Information Center. However, the problem with this is that the information it contains is considered confidential, and therefore, not accessible to the public. What it does have is a public list of most wanted people. You can use this list as basis for your free IL State criminal records, too.
